Your guide to Houston

Introduction

Southern culture weaves through America’s fourth-largest city, an enormous metropolis that people from around the world call home. From its location on the Gulf of Mexico, it embodies the stereotype of everything being bigger in Texas, while also taking everything slow, as befits its Southern nature. The city is home to Rice University, the University of Houston, and NASA and much of the American space industry, while an exciting culinary scene stems from the many immigrant entrepreneurs. Downtown Houston’s bustling urbanity hosts a variety of professional sports teams, theaters, and live music venues, while suburbs offer slower options, like the greenery of Pearland, or the small-town feel of Sugar Land and Cypress.


The best time to stay in a vacation rental in Houston

Houston’s spring tends to be pleasant, with average high temperatures in the 70s Fahrenheit and lows in the 50s and the least amount of rain of the year. Winter is a bit cooler, but similarly comfortable. Summer teeters toward extremely hot, with average highs hitting the mid-90s and the lows staying well above 70 degrees, accompanied by significant humidity. The hot weather comes in tandem with the rain — especially in June, which averages more than six inches. Summer also brings hurricane season in Houston, which can bring wild rains until fall — so you should always be aware of the current forecasts when visiting.


Top things to do in Houston

Space Center Houston

The public is invited to explore one of the country’s main training, research, and flight control centers. The giant center offers tram tours, galleries, interactive exhibits, and displays of artifacts that show off the history of human space flight. Moon rocks, simulated capsule rides, and shuttle replicas help you understand space and what’s involved in exploring it.

Buffalo Bayou Park

This 160-acre park is located along a 2.3-mile stretch of the Buffalo Bayou near downtown. You can hike, stroll, bike, or paddle here; boat and kayak rentals are available. Along with traditional park amenities, the space includes a decorative fountain and a bat colony with observation deck, while a dog park, nature play area for kids, and a skate park mean the park has something for everyone.

Houston Museum District

Just outside the city’s downtown core, the Museum District brings together many of Houston’s most important cultural institutions. The walkable neighborhood features 19 institutions, including the Museum of Fine Arts, one of the biggest art museums in the country; a children’s museum; museums that focus on local African-American, Czech, and Asian culture; and a chapel.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• How is the weather in Houston?

    Houston generally has a humid subtropical climate. It experiences mild winters and hot, humid summers, with temperatures often reaching 95°F (35°C). Spring and fall bring pleasant temperatures, often ranging between 70°F (21°C) and 85°F (29°C). Houston does have a hurricane season running from June to November.

  • What are some of the best things to do in Houston?

    Visitors to Houston often enjoy exploring the Museum District, visiting the Space Center, or experiencing a basketball game at the Toyota Center. Others might like to spend time in the Houston Zoo or relax in the beautiful Discovery Green Park.

  • What is the best time of year to visit Houston?

    Spring (March to May) and fall (September to November) are often the most popular times to visit Houston, thanks to pleasant weather. The Houston Livestock Show and Rodeo in March is a large annual event that attracts many visitors.

  • What are the best places to stay in Houston?

    Downtown Houston is frequently suggested, known for its skyscrapers, shopping centers, and vibrant nightlife. The Museum District is also popular, being close to numerous museums and Hermann Park. Montrose, known for its eclectic vibe and vintage shops, is another area often recommended by guests.

  • What are the best places to visit in Houston?

    Many visitors explore the Houston Museum of Natural Science, Space Center Houston, or the Houston Zoo. Art lovers might appreciate a visit to The Menil Collection, while nature enthusiasts often enjoy the Houston Botanic Garden.

  • What are some hiking trails in Houston?

    Buffalo Bayou Park has scenic urban trails, while the Houston Arboretum & Nature Center offers more forested paths. Memorial Park, one of the largest urban parks in the U.S., also has a variety of trails for beginners to experienced hikers.

  • What are some family activities to do in Houston?

    Families often enjoy visiting the Houston Zoo, exploring the Children's Museum Houston, or having fun at the Space Center Houston. A picnic at the Buffalo Bayou Park or a visit to the interactive Houston Museum of Natural Science is also typically enjoyed by families.

  • What are some of the best day trip ideas in Houston?

    You might consider a trip to the nearby Galveston Island for its historic architecture, beaches, and the Moody Gardens. For nature lovers, Brazos Bend State Park is frequently suggested and is less than 50 miles (80 km) away. Kemah Boardwalk, known for its fun rides and waterfront restaurants, is also a favorite amongst guests.
